Learn How to Promote a Passed Pawn: Endgame Tactics
In this chess endgame, the key idea is that an advanced passed pawn can outweigh material if the enemy king and pieces are too far away to stop it. The stronger side often uses queen activity and king safety pressure to force concessions, while the defender must watch for tactical resources that keep the pawn from queening. In classical chess, these positions reward precision: one tempo can decide whether the pawn promotes or gets blockaded.
